connect vm to log analytics workspace terraform

Following is an example of a Resource Manager template that's used for deploying a virtual machine that's running Windows with the MMA extension installed. Confirm the MMA extension heartbeat task is running using the following steps: Confirm the task is enabled and is running every 1 minute, Ensure the virtual machine can run PowerShell scripts, Ensure permissions on C:\Windows\temp havent been changed, View the status of the MMA by typing the following in a powershell window with elevated permission on the virtual machine, For other unhealthy statuses review the OMS Agent for Linux VM extension logs in, If the extension status is healthy, but data is not being uploaded review the OMS Agent for Linux log files in. Prior to onboarding agents, you must create and configure a workspace. rev2023.5.1.43405. After my validation, you can add the DependencyAgent extension to your existing code.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Terraform module to deploy Log Analytics workspace with option to add solutions to it. From the Workspace main blade, go to WORKSPACE DATA SOURCE - Virtual machines, select the VM and in the new blade that opens to the right click the button "Connect".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. PowerShell script C:\Packages\Plugins\Microsoft.Compute.CustomScriptExtension\XXX\Downloads\YY, C:\WindowsAzure\Logs\Plugins\Microsoft.Compute.CustomScriptExtension\ZZZ. See Supported operating systems to ensure that the operating system of the virtual machine or virtual machine scale set you're enabling is supported. In the details for your virtual machine, select, After you install and connect the agent, the, Microsoft.EnterpriseCloud.Monitoring resource extension section, Outputs to look up the workspaceId and workspaceSharedKey, Check if the Azure VM agent is installed and working correctly by using the steps in. It is desirable to implement it from day one into your architecture. Is there a generic term for these trajectories? Why are players required to record the moves in World Championship Classical games? You can then use this workspace for other agents. Using Terraform, you create configuration files using HCL syntax. If you've migrated your virtual machines to Azure Monitor Agent and no longer want to support virtual machines with the Log Analytics agent in your workspace, remove the VMInsights solution from the workspace. The steps listed below must be completed in order to deploy a Windows Virtual Desktop host pool with Terraform. To support Azure Monitor Agent, a standard Log Analytics workspace must be created as described in Create a Log Analytics workspace. Enabling debug logging for VMware Tools within a guest operating system Select the Solutions menu in the Azure portal. The sizes of the optional managed data disks. The URL in which the RDS components exists. Did the Golden Gate Bridge 'flatten' under the weight of 300,000 people in 1987? @NancyXiong also true my bad, deleted some of my tries to add insights and that comma got lost. Microsoft offers a Log Analytics Workspace where you can store logs and virtual machine extensions to send data from a guest operating . Interpreting non-statistically significant results: Do we have "no evidence" or "insufficient evidence" to reject the null? To walk you through the processes outlined in this post, please watch my video tutorial: You must be a registered user to add a comment. Initialize Terraform 5. Why the obscure but specific description of Jane Doe II in the original complaint for Westenbroek v. Kappa Kappa Gamma Fraternity? For multiple regions it can be advantagious to deploy one in each region, as recommended by Microsoft. Can my creature spell be countered if I cast a split second spell after it? What differentiates living as mere roommates from living in a marriage-like relationship? Which reverse polarity protection is better and why? Passing negative parameters to a wolframscript. Clean up resources Troubleshoot Terraform on Azure Next steps Article tested with the following Terraform and Terraform provider versions: Terraform v1.1.7 AzureRM Provider v.2.99.0 Did you try tom use type_handler_version = "1. avinor/terraform-azurerm-log-analytics - Github registry.terraform.io/modules/avinor/log-analytics/azurerm. For Starship, using B9 and later, how will separation work if the Hydrualic Power Units are no longer needed for the TVC System? Asking for help, clarification, or responding to other answers.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Canadian of Polish descent travel to Poland with Canadian passport. Find out more about the Microsoft MVP Award Program. Open deployed log analytics workspace and go to "Workspace Data Sources" -> "Azure Activity log" and connect to subscriptions that should collect activity logs. Azure Log Analytics: Deploying the first log analytics workspace azure - Terraform issue setting up VM logging 'Microsoft More info about Internet Explorer and Microsoft Edge, Design a Log Analytics workspace configuration, removing any other solution from a workspace, Targeting monitoring solutions in Azure Monitor (preview). https://learn.microsoft.com/en-us/azure/virtual-machines/extensions/agent-dependency-windows. If you've already registered, sign in. _resource_group.rg.location resource_group_name = azurerm_resource_group.rg.name workspace_resource_id . The consent submitted will only be used for data processing originating from this website.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. This command downloads the Azure provider required to manage your Azure resources. You will be charged for both data sources.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. But it just reports invalid format for type_handler_version. This is the powershell command to disconnect the vm from the workspace: Thanks for contributing an answer to Stack Overflow! Deploy VM with as usual with OMSAgent and DependencyAgentWindows extensions: OMS for Windows:

Volkswagen Financial Services Uk, 1,000 Facts About The Rainforest, Articles C

connect vm to log analytics workspace terraform